Transaction 196689defed56a5bebd4207d5343edb45ca1bfb24bc787367e1e2543c1c40bd9
1 Input
1 Output
-
196689defed56a5bebd4207d5343edb45ca1bfb24bc787367e1e2543c1c40bd9:0
- value
- 2251586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04c47c4c17f1b1c6fbe326388cd989520db8b0df OP_EQUAL
- address
- 328E1N9fHNmgZKfhegjsF3amyWEhUpGJdT